How does Natural Language Understanding (NLU) work?

Answer:

Natural language understanding (NLU) is a branch of natural language processing, which involves transforming human language into a machine-readable format.

Explanation:

NLU is branch of natural language processing (NLP), which helps computers understand and interpret human language by breaking down the elemental pieces of speech. While speech recognition captures spoken language in real-time, transcribes it, and returns text, NLU goes beyond recognition to determine a user's intent.
